基于分层空时结构的多码CDMA系统中一种新的迭代均衡接收算法的研究
A novel turbo-equalization algorithm for multicode CDMA with V-BLAST architecture
【摘要】 为了提高基于垂直结构的分层空时结构(V-BLAST, vertical bell-laboratories layered space-time)的多码 CDMA 系统的抗干扰能力与系统容量,文章提出了一种将 MMSE 均衡与 Turbo 译码联合运算进行的方法,得到了一种针对该系统的迭代均衡接收算法。该接收算法包含两个连续的软输入软输出模块,首先经过 MMSE 均衡后得到第一个软输出,然后从 Turbo 译码器得到第二个软输出。每一次迭代过程中,从均衡和译码中得到的外赋信息作为第二次迭代的先验信息。仿真结果表明,文章提出的迭代均衡接收算法相比较传统非迭代接收算法,性能有非常可观的改善。
【Abstract】 To suppress the interference and improve capacity of multicode CDMA with V-BLAST architecture, a novel method of joint MMSE equalizer and Turbo decoding was proposed in this paper. Also, a novel Turbo equalizer structure was obtained. The receiver performs two successive soft input soft output, first from a MMSE equalizer and then from a Turbo decoder and was used as a priori information for the next iteration. Simulation results demonstrate that the proposed Turbo equalizer offers significant performance gain over traditional non-iterative receiver structures.
【Key words】 multicode CDMA; V-BLAST architecture; Turbo equalization; soft input soft output;
